利用RNAi 介导的抗病性获得抗2 种花生病毒的转基因烟草

摘    要: 分别以花生条纹病毒红安株系(PStV-Hongan)外壳蛋白基因(CP),花生矮化病毒轻型株系(PSV-Mi)和花生黄瓜花叶病毒(CMV-CA)复制酶基因2a为模板,通过PCR 方法分别得到PStV-CP 5′ 端,PSV-Mi 和CMV-CA 2a3′ 端150 bp 的片段,3 种片段混合物为模板经PCR 拼接得到450 bp 的片段,此拼接片段通过Gateway 系统重组至植物表达载体pK7GW1WG2,得到含反向重复拼接片段的植物表达载体pK450。冻融法导入根癌农杆菌(Agrobacterium tumefaciens)菌株GV3101 后,叶盘法转化本生烟(Nicotiana benthamiana),经PCR 检测,获得转基因植株。对T1 代转基因植株分别人工接种3 种病毒,66. 7% 的植株表现对PStV 免疫,9% 的植株表现对CMV-CA 的恢复抗性,全部植株对PSV 感病。siRNA 的Northern blot 结果表明,所有转基因烟草植株都含有病毒特异siRNA,siRNA 含量随接种后时间延长而衰减。

Transgenic tobacco plants resistant to two peanut viruses via RNA mediated virus resistance

Abstract:Specific primers were designed according to the coat protein(CP) genes of Peanut stripe virus Hongan isolate(PStV-Hongan),2a gene of Peanut stunt virus-mild strin(PSV-Mi) and Cucumber mosaic virus peanut strain(CMV-CA),and cDNA fragments with length of 150 bp were obtained from the 5′ ends of CP gene of PStV-Hongan,3′ end of replicase 2a gene of PSV-Mi and CMV-CA.The three cDNA fragments were recombined into one chimeric cDNA by PCR amplification.The chimeric cDNA was then introduced into the plant expressing vector pK7GW1WG2 in a way of inverted repeats by Gateway recombination Kits.The identified plant-expression plasmid pK450 was introduced into Agrobacterium tumefaciens GV3101 by direct transferring,and the target cDNA with inverted repeats was introduced into Nicotiana benthamiana.Transgenic plants obtained by tissue culture and identified by PCR.The resistance assay indicated that about 66.7% of T1 transgenic plants were immune to PStV,9% of the transgenic plants were recovered after CMV inoculation and all the plants were susceptible to PSV.siRNA was found in all transgenic plants by Northern-blot test and its amount decreased with the time after inoculation.
